中文摘要:真空薄层蒸结(vacuum thin film evaporation and crystallization, VTFEC) 工艺基于真空条件下, 液体沸点降低的原理, 可对高盐溶液、三效蒸发工艺浓缩液等蒸发结晶处理。该工艺主要包含蒸发器预换热、逐级蒸发- 浓缩-结晶以及干化工序, 采用VTFEC 工艺蒸结处理Na2SO4 高盐溶液, 可同步实现高盐溶液的快速浓缩、结晶和干化,出料端收集的结晶盐呈干燥粉末, 颗粒大小均匀, 平均含水率约为5.75%。利用该工艺蒸结处理三效蒸发工艺浓缩液, 结果表明, COD和氨氮平均去除率分别为95.5% 和83.9%, 出料端产物的平均含水率为5.91%。此外, VTFEC工艺在负压条件下运行, 有助于改善传统敞开式干化工艺从业人员的工作环境。

Engineering Application and Research of Vacuum Thin Film Evaporation and Crystallization System
Abstract:Vacuum thin film evaporation and crystallization system( VTFEC), based on the principle of reduced liquid boiling point under vacuum conditions, can perform Evaporation and crystallization treatment on high-salinity solutions and concentrated solutions from the triple-effect evaporation process. The process mainly includes evaporator preheating, gradual evaporation-concentration-crystallization, and drying procedures. Using VTFEC process to treat simulated high-salinity sodium sulfate solution, it can simultaneously achieve rapid concentration, crystallization and drying of high-salinity solutions. The crystalline salt collected at the discharge end is in the form of dry powder, with uniform particle size and average moisture content is 5.75%. Using this process for triple-effect evaporation concentrate, it shows that average removal rate of COD and ammonia nitrogen are 95.5% and 83.9% respectively, and average moisture content of the product at the discharge end is 5.91%. Additionally, the VTFEC process operates under negative pressure, which can significantly improve the working environment for personnel engaged in the traditional open-type drying process.
